Dual-channel photoplethysmography synchronization using a Barker sequence

Conf Proc IEEE Eng Med Biol Soc. 2005:2005:1952-5. doi: 10.1109/IEMBS.2005.1616835.

Abstract

A Barker sequence is employed for the synchronization of two photoplethysmogram (PPG) channels. The correctness of this technique is demonstrated by recording a PPG signal, injecting a Barker sequence at the start of this trace and producing a delayed version of it. After preprocessing, cross-correlation techniques are utilized for accurate time alignment of the two traces. The algorithm can correct for any time misalignment as long as the synchronization sequence appears on both channels.
